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services varies widely, generally ranging from $2,000 to $7,500 dep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Smaller cracks or minor repairs tend to be on the lower end, while major foundation issues can significantly increase costs.
Factors Influencing Cost - Costs are influenced by factors such as the size of the property, the severity of foundation issues, and the repair techniques required. For example, underpinning may cost around $3,000 to $10,000 for larger projects in the Goodlettsville area.
Material and Method Costs - Different repair materials and methods impact overall costs, with epoxy injections costing approximately $1,500 to $3,000 for minor cracks, while piering systems can range from $3,000 to over $10,000 for extensive foundation stabilization.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include permits, soil stabilization, or excavation, which can add several thousand dollars to the project.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ific foundation conditions and property size.

What are signs of foundation problems? Common ind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or exterior walls.
How do contractors repair foundation issues? Repair methods vary and may invol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, depending on the severity and type of foundation problem.
What causes foundation damage? Factors such as so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, and moisture fluctuations can contribute to foundation issues over time.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method, with some projects completing within a few days and others taking longer.
